You can swap which side you want to show off when casting the spell, or just stick with your favorite. You can even flip a coin to pick! It’s just another way you can express yourself when playing the game. These are double-sided cards, but they have the same functional card on each side. However, each side has different art. Reversible cards are a cool new piece of Magic tech we’re excited to debut here. It’s a relatively straightforward concept, but it results in some awesome looking cards. Reversible Cards?
